Who's on The Graham Norton Show today?

This week will see Norton joined by Hollywood star Geena Davis who will be discussing her new memoir Dying of Politeness.

Davis is most known for her roles in hit films Thelma & Louise, A League of Their Own, Beetlejuice, Tootsie and many more. 

Also on the couch is actor Stephen Graham, who discusses his role in the powerful true crime drama The Walk-In.

Graham has been in a range of popular shows and films, including Line of Duty, Help, Time, Snatch, The Irishman, and Venom: Let There be Carnage. 

Strictly judge Motsi Mabuse will be chatting about her new autobiography Finding My Own Rhythm.

Whilst bringing the music is award-winning grime artist, Stormzy performing his new song Hide and Seek.
